Package org.fest.swing.fixture

Examples of org.fest.swing.fixture.JPanelFixture


* @author Ralf Stephan <ralf@ark.in-berlin.de>
*/
public class Issue116Test extends AbstractAppletTest {

    @Test public void testIssue116() {
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        applet.button("H").click();
        panel.get2DHub().updateView();
        applet.panel("renderpanel").robot.waitForIdle();
        panel.get2DHub().mouseClickedDown(100, 100);
View Full Code Here


import org.openscience.jchempaint.matchers.ComboBoxTextComponentMatcher;

public class BugSF75Test extends AbstractAppletTest {

    @Test public void testBug75() throws CDKException, ClassNotFoundException, IOException, CloneNotSupportedException{
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        applet.button("hexagon").click();
        applet.click();
        applet.panel("renderpanel").robot.click(applet.panel("renderpanel").component(), new Point(100,100), MouseButton.LEFT_BUTTON,1);
        applet.button("eraser").click();
View Full Code Here

*/
public class Issue19Test extends AbstractAppletTest {

    @Test public void testIssue19() throws AWTException {
      Robot robot = new Robot();
      J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        applet.button("C").click();
        applet.panel("renderpanel").robot.click(applet.panel("renderpanel").component(),new Point(100,100));
        applet.button("select").click();
        applet.panel("renderpanel").robot.click(applet.panel("renderpanel").component(),new Point(100,100));
View Full Code Here

* @author Ralf Stephan <ralf@ark.in-berlin.de>
*/
public class Issue71Test extends AbstractAppletTest {

    @Test public void testIssue71() throws AWTException {
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        applet.button("C").click();
        applet.button("bondTool").click();
        applet.panel("renderpanel").robot.click(applet.panel("renderpanel").component(),new Point(100,100));
        applet.button("select").click();
View Full Code Here

* @author <ralf@ark.in-berlin.de>
*/
public class Issue82Test extends AbstractAppletTest {

  @Test public void testIssue82() {
    JPanelFixture jcppanel=applet.panel("appletframe");
    JChemPaintPanel pane = (JChemPaintPanel)jcppanel.target;
    applet.button("C").click();
    applet.button("bondTool").click();
    pane.get2DHub().mouseClickedDown(300, 100);
    pane.get2DHub().updateView();
View Full Code Here

* @author Ralf Stephan <ralf@ark.in-berlin.de>
*/
public class Issue40Test extends AbstractAppletTest {

    @Test public void testIssue40() {
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        applet.button("C").click();
        applet.button("chain").click();
        panel.get2DHub().mouseClickedDown(100, 100);
        panel.get2DHub().mouseDrag(100, 100, 300, 100);
View Full Code Here

import org.junit.Test;

public class Issue4Test extends AbstractAppletTest {

    @Test public void testIssue4() {
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        applet.button("C").click();
        applet.button("C").click();
        applet.panel("renderpanel").robot.click(applet.panel("renderpanel").component(),new Point(100,100));
        applet.button("select").click();
View Full Code Here

* error handling (#11). Depends on cdk SF#3531612.
*/
public class Issue11Test extends AbstractAppletTest {

    @Test public void testIssue11() {
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        try {
          jcpApplet.setSmiles("[NH4+].CP(=O)(O)CCC(N)C(=O)[O-]");
          panel.get2DHub().updateView();
    } catch (Exception e) {
View Full Code Here

* @author <ralf@ark.in-berlin.de>
*/
public class Issue8Test extends AbstractAppletTest {

  @Test public void testIssue8() {
    JPanelFixture jcppanel=applet.panel("appletframe");
    JChemPaintPanel pane = (JChemPaintPanel)jcppanel.target;
    applet.button("chain").click();
    pane.get2DHub().updateView();
    applet.panel("renderpanel").robot.waitForIdle();
    pane.get2DHub().mouseClickedDown(100, 100);
View Full Code Here

* Tests SMILES input in general.
*/
public class Issue81Test extends AbstractAppletTest {

    @Test public void testIssue81() {
        JPanelFixture jcppanel=applet.panel("appletframe");
        JChemPaintPanel panel = (JChemPaintPanel)jcppanel.target;
        try {
          jcpApplet.setSmiles("CCCC");
          panel.get2DHub().updateView();
    } catch (Exception e) {
View Full Code Here

TOP

Related Classes of org.fest.swing.fixture.JPanelFixture

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.